Chania

Chania is a city on the northwest coast of the Greek island of Crete. Chania is Crete's most evocative city, with its pretty Venetian quarter, crisscrossed by narrow lanes, culminating at a magnificent harbor. At the harbor entrance is a 16th-century lighthouse with Venetian, Egyptian, and Ottoman influences. On the other side, the Nautical Museum has model ships, naval objects and photographs. The former monastery of St. Francis houses the Archaeological Museum of Chania. Remnants of Venetian and Turkish architecture abound, with old townhouses now transformed into atmospheric restaurants and boutique hotels. Although all this beauty means the old town is packed with tourists in summer, it's still a great place to unwind. The Venetian Harbor is super for a stroll and a coffee or cocktail. Plus it’s got a university and a modern area to the city, which means that it retains its charm in winter. Indie boutiques and an entire lane dedicated to leather products provide good shopping and, with a multitude of creative restaurants, you’ll likely have some of your best meals on Crete here.

Brasov

Brasov is a mountain resort city in the region of Transylvania in Romania, surrounded by the Carpathian Mountains and best known for its medieval architecture and history.

Which place is cheaper, Brasov or Chania?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Chania is €93, while the average daily cost in Brasov is €56.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Chania and Brasov in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Chania or Brasov?

Both destinations experience a temperate climate with four distinct seasons. And since both cities are in the northern hemisphere, summer is in July and winter is in January.

Should I visit Chania or Brasov in the Summer?

The summer attracts plenty of travelers to both Chania and Brasov. The summer months attract visitors to Chania because of the beaches, snorkeling, the hiking, the city activities, and the family-friendly experiences.

In the summer, Chania is a little warmer than Brasov. Typically, the summer temperatures in Chania in July average around 26°C (80°F), and Brasov averages at about 23°C (73°F).

People are often attracted to the plentiful sunshine in Brasov this time of the year. In Chania, it's very sunny this time of the year. Chania usually receives more sunshine than Brasov during summer. Chania gets 380 hours of sunny skies, while Brasov receives 288 hours of full sun in the summer.

In July, Chania usually receives less rain than Brasov. Chania gets 1 mm (0 in) of rain, while Brasov receives 62 mm (2.4 in) of rain each month for the summer.

Should I visit Chania or Brasov in the Autumn?

The autumn brings many poeple to Chania as well as Brasov. The hiking trails, the city's sights and attractions, and the shopping scene are the main draw to Chania this time of year.

In October, Chania is generally much warmer than Brasov. Daily temperatures in Chania average around 20°C (68°F), and Brasov fluctuates around 13°C (55°F).

In the autumn, Chania often gets around the same amount of sunshine as Brasov. Chania gets 198 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Brasov receives 187 hours of full sun.

Chania usually gets more rain in October than Brasov. Chania gets 80 mm (3.1 in) of rain, while Brasov receives 26 mm (1 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Chania or Brasov in the Winter?

Both Brasov and Chania are popular destinations to visit in the winter with plenty of activities. Many travelers come to Chania for the museums, the shopping scene, and the cuisine.

Brasov can get quite cold in the winter. Chania is much warmer than Brasov in the winter. The daily temperature in Chania averages around 12°C (54°F) in January, and Brasov fluctuates around -1°C (30°F).

Chania usually receives more sunshine than Brasov during winter. Chania gets 118 hours of sunny skies, while Brasov receives 85 hours of full sun in the winter.

It's quite rainy in Chania. In January, Chania usually receives more rain than Brasov. Chania gets 142 mm (5.6 in) of rain, while Brasov receives 28 mm (1.1 in) of rain each month for the winter.

Should I visit Chania or Brasov in the Spring?

Both Brasov and Chania during the spring are popular places to visit. Many visitors come to Chania in the spring for the beaches and the activities around the city.

In the spring, Chania is a little warmer than Brasov. Typically, the spring temperatures in Chania in April average around 17°C (62°F), and Brasov averages at about 12°C (54°F).

It's quite sunny in Chania. In the spring, Chania often gets more sunshine than Brasov. Chania gets 237 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Brasov receives 188 hours of full sun.

Chania usually gets less rain in April than Brasov. Chania gets 32 mm (1.3 in) of rain, while Brasov receives 40 mm (1.6 in) of rain this time of the year.
